HVAC custom-size air filters

Can someone recommend a source for custom-size air filters for residential HVAC?

I need 1"x25"x22" filters, and the closest sizes I've seen (at my local WalMart, HomeDepot, Lowe's) were 1x25x25 and 1x25x20.

If it were me, I'd cut the 1x25x25 to fit and seal the cut edge with tape. Or I might try the other size and see if it really matters.

This might be a temporary solution until you can find the right size.

Grainger sells filter rolls so you can cut your own size. Maybe you can get a sheet metal shop to fabricate a frame for you.

I had the local HVAC outfit make me a washable filter. A trip to the hose/shower once a month, and a whiff of spray on filter oil. No more replacable filters. Cost was only $10!
